The Double Glazing Overview
Double glazing describes the installation of 2 panes of glass within a single window system, separated by a space filled with gas or air. The advantages of this innovation consist of:
Enhanced Insulation: The caught air or gas layer provides better thermal insulation, lowering energy bills.Noise Reduction: The two-layer system functions as a barrier against external noise, developing a more tranquil indoor environment.Condensation Prevention: Double glazing minimizes the possibility of condensation forming on the interior surface area of the glass, thus improving exposure and maintaining visual appeals.Increased Security: The usage of 2 panes of glass creates an extra layer of security against burglaries.Table 1: Key Benefits of Double GlazingBenefitDescriptionEnhanced InsulationDecreases heat loss, resulting in lower energy costs.Noise ReductionReduces outside sound interference.Condensation PreventionDecreases wetness accumulation inside the house.Increased SecuritySupplies an extra barrier versus possible intruders.Enhanced AestheticsModern creates elevate the appearance of homes.The Installation Process

1. Initial Consultation
This step consists of assessing the current windows, talking about the homeowner's needs, and providing an estimate. Property owners should take this chance to ask concerns and clarify any doubts about products or designs.
2. Measurement and Customization
Accurate measurements are crucial for a successful installation. A service technician will measure each window frame and lay out the specs necessary for custom-made production.
3. Removal of Existing Windows
The old windows will require to be thoroughly removed. This action will need tools and know-how to make sure the surrounding structure remains undamaged.
4. Installation of New Double Glazed Units
The new double-glazed windows are fitted into the existing frame or a brand-new frame if required. Sealants and insulation products are applied to guarantee energy efficiency and avoid leakages.
5. Final Adjustments and Finishing Touches
After installation, any spaces will be sealed, and finishing touches will be applied, consisting of painting or trimming as necessary.

The installation of local double glazing companies glazing can differ considerably depending on different aspects, including the size of the windows, type of glass, and labor expenses. Here's a rough expense breakdown:
Table 3: Cost BreakdownElementApproximated Cost (per window)Standard Double Glazing₤ 300 - ₤ 700High-end or Custom Design₤ 700 - ₤ 1,200Installation Labor₤ 100 - ₤ 300Extra Materials₤ 50 - ₤ 150
In general, property owners can expect to invest in between ₤ 500 and ₤ 1,500 per window, factoring in both products and installation.

Q: Is double glazing worth the investment?A: Yes, double
glazing can significantly decrease energy costs in the long term and improve home convenience levels.
Q: How long does double glazing last?A: Quality double
glazing can last anywhere from 20 to 35 years, depending upon maintenance and ecological elements. Q: Can I install double glazing myself?A:
While DIY installation is possible for skilled people, hiring specialists is suggested to guarantee compliance with structure guidelines and quality standards. Q: Will double glazing lower outside noise?A: Yes, double glazing works at minimizing outdoorsnoise by functioning as a sound barrier. Q: Is there a distinction in between double glazing and triple glazing?A: Yes, triple glazing consists of three panes of glass and provides even better
